I just wanted to let everyone know of an issue I had with the Serverpac 
Install.  First, YES - I did not read the PSP.  So it is not a surprise I made 
a small miscalculation.

In Dec 2007 there was a fix that was release for GIMUNZIP.  It has to do with 
SB37 abends on SYSUT1 during the Unzip of a PDS/E (POE) data set.  Apparently 
IBM has hardcoded in the GIMUNZIP process how much space to dynamically 
allocate for SYSUT1 when recreating the PDS/E data set from teh archive file.  
This is what causes the SB37.  The SCEEMOD2 data set is much bigger today than 
under z/OS V1.7.

So I had to install the following fixes  UO00674  UO00678   and UO00649.

Once I had these installed and added (apf' authorized) to the RECEIVE JOBLIB 
statement, everything is running much better.

There are two issues that I will bring up with IBM at the next Share I attend.  
Why is this hardcoded and not part of an ARCHDEF control card statement?  And 
two, we have FASTCOPY (PDSMAN) in shop.  I have to manually add the JCL 
statement //FCOPYOFF DD DUMMY to all steps before I submit.  Otherwise I get 
bad errors when FASTCOPY tries to work on PDSE data sets.
